> > > > > > > The BUILD_BUG_ON_MSG() check against "~0ull" works only with "unsigned
> > > > > > > (long) long" _mask types.  For constant masks, that condition is usually
> > > > > > > met, as GENMASK() yields an UL value.  The few places where the
> > > > > > > constant mask is stored in an intermediate variable were fixed by
> > > > > > > changing the variable type to u64 (see e.g. [1] and [2]).
> > > > > > >
> > > > > > > However, for non-constant masks, smaller unsigned types should be valid,
> > > > > > > too, but currently lead to "result of comparison of constant
> > > > > > > 18446744073709551615 with expression of type ... is always
> > > > > > > false"-warnings with clang and W=1.
> > > > > > >
> > > > > > > Hence refactor the __BF_FIELD_CHECK() helper, and factor out
> > > > > > > __FIELD_{GET,PREP}().  The later lack the single problematic check, but
> > > > > > > are otherwise identical to FIELD_{GET,PREP}(), and are intended to be
> > > > > > > used in the fully non-const variants later.

> > > The extra checking in field_prep() in case the compiler can
> > > determine that the mask is a constant already found a possible bug
> > > in drivers/net/wireless/realtek/rtw89/core.c:rtw89_roc_end():
> > >
> > >     rtw89_write32_mask(rtwdev, reg, B_AX_RX_FLTR_CFG_MASK, rtwdev->hal.rx_fltr);
> > >
> > > drivers/net/wireless/realtek/rtw89/reg.h:
> > >
> > >     #define B_AX_RX_MPDU_MAX_LEN_MASK GENMASK(21, 16)
> > >     #define B_AX_RX_FLTR_CFG_MASK ((u32)~B_AX_RX_MPDU_MAX_LEN_MASK)
> > >
> > > so it looks like B_AX_RX_FLTR_CFG_MASK is not the proper mask for
> > > this operation...
> >
> > The purpose of the statements is to update values excluding bits of
> > B_AX_RX_MPDU_MAX_LEN_MASK. The use of B_AX_RX_FLTR_CFG_MASK is tricky, but
> > the operation is correct because bit 0 is set, so __ffs(mask) returns 0 in
> > rtw89_write32_mask(). Then, operation looks like
> >
> >    orig = read(reg);
> >    new = (orig & ~mask) | (data & mask);
> >    write(new);
> >
> > Since we don't use FIELD_{GET,PREP} macros with B_AX_RX_FLTR_CFG_MASK, how
> > can you find the problem? Please guide us. Thanks.
